Abstract

<P>PROBLEM TO BE SOLVED: To provide a lock mechanism of a vehicle door capable of locking a door with a gap formed between a door and a vehicle body. <P>SOLUTION: This lock mechanism of a vehicle door locks the door 19 which is openably and closably provided to a vehicle body 20. While a vehicle body side lock part 22 is provided to a vehicle body 20 for locking a door 19 under a closed condition, a lock member 23 capable of projecting inside and outside a vehicle body 20 is arranged to the vehicle body 20. While the lock member 23 is projecting outside the vehicle body 20 relative to the vehicle body side lock part 22, the lock member 23 is constituted to be engageable with a door side lock part 21 provided to the door 19. <P>COPYRIGHT: (C)2010,JPO&INPIT

Description

本発明は、車体に開閉可能に取り付けた扉をロックするための車両用扉のロック機構と、その車両用扉のロック機構を備えた入浴車に関する。   The present invention relates to a vehicle door lock mechanism for locking a door attached to a vehicle body so as to be openable and closable, and a bath car provided with the vehicle door lock mechanism.

例えば、寝たきりの老人や病人、あるいは身体の不自由な者などを入浴させるために、移動式の浴槽や給湯装置等を搭載した入浴車がある(特許文献1参照)。この種の入浴車を用いて入浴対象者を入浴させる場合は、一般的に、入浴車が訪問先に到着した後、車両の扉を開放して、浴槽を車外に搬出して入浴対象者の近くまで運び込み、車内に設けた給湯装置の送湯口と車外に運び出した浴槽の給湯口とをホースで連結する。そして、給湯装置から送り出す湯水をホースを介して浴槽へ供給するようにしている。   For example, there is a bath car equipped with a mobile bathtub, a hot water supply device, or the like for bathing a bedridden elderly person or sick person or a physically handicapped person (see Patent Document 1). When bathing a person using a bath of this kind, generally, after the bath arrives at the destination, the door of the vehicle is opened, the bathtub is taken out of the car and the bath Carry it close and connect the hot water outlet of the hot water supply device installed in the car and the hot water outlet of the bathtub carried out of the car with a hose. And the hot water sent out from a hot-water supply apparatus is supplied to a bathtub via a hose.

浴槽へ湯水を供給している間は、車内から車外に渡ってホースが延びているため、扉を閉じてロックすることができない。このため、車内に設けた機材や貴重品等の盗難や、車内への雨水の浸入の虞がある。   While hot water is being supplied to the bathtub, the hose extends from the inside of the vehicle to the outside of the vehicle, so the door cannot be closed and locked. For this reason, there is a risk of theft of equipment and valuables provided in the vehicle and intrusion of rainwater into the vehicle.

そこで、給湯装置の送湯口等を車外に露出させて配設した入浴車が提案されている(特許文献2参照)。送湯口等を車外に露出させて配設したことによって、ホースを車両の内外に渡って配設しなくてもよくなるため、浴槽へ湯水を供給している間、扉を閉じてロックすることが可能となる。
特開2000−325421号公報 実用新案登録第3076900号公報
Therefore, a bathing car has been proposed in which a hot water supply port of a hot water supply device is exposed outside the vehicle (see Patent Document 2). By arranging the hot water outlet etc. exposed outside the vehicle, it is not necessary to arrange the hose over the inside and outside of the vehicle. Therefore, it is possible to close and lock the door while supplying hot water to the bathtub. It becomes possible.
JP 2000-325421 A Utility Model Registration No. 3076900

しかしながら、給湯装置の送湯口を車外に露出させて配設するのは、配管構造等が複雑になり高コストとなる問題がある。また、ホースを車外で使用するため、ホースリールを車外に運び出さなければならず、作業効率の観点から好ましくなかった。   However, arranging the hot water supply port of the hot water supply device so as to be exposed to the outside of the vehicle has a problem that the piping structure and the like are complicated and the cost is high. Further, since the hose is used outside the vehicle, the hose reel must be carried out of the vehicle, which is not preferable from the viewpoint of work efficiency.

本発明は、斯かる実情に鑑みて、扉と車体との間に隙間を形成した状態で扉をロックすることができる車両用扉のロック機構、及びそのロック機構を備えた入浴車を提供する。   In view of such circumstances, the present invention provides a lock mechanism for a vehicle door that can lock the door in a state where a gap is formed between the door and the vehicle body, and a bath car equipped with the lock mechanism. .

以下、添付の図面に基づいて、本発明の車両用扉のロック機構を入浴車に適用した場合の実施形態について説明する。   DESCRIPTION OF EMBODIMENTS Hereinafter, an embodiment in which a vehicle door locking mechanism of the present invention is applied to a bathing vehicle will be described with reference to the accompanying drawings.

図1は入浴車の平面図、図2は前記入浴車の側面図である。図1及び図2に示すように、本発明の入浴車1は、車外に搬出可能な浴槽2を備える。また、本発明の入浴車1は、浴用水供給装置として、浴用水を貯水するための貯水タンク3と、貯水タンク3に貯水された浴用水を加熱するための給湯ボイラー4と、給湯ボイラー4の燃料となる灯油を貯留するための灯油タンク5と、貯水タンク3内の浴用水を送り出すための送水ポンプ6を備えている。給湯ボイラー4には排煙筒11が取り付けられており、この排煙筒11によって給湯ボイラー4から発生した煙を車外へ導いて排気するようになっている。   FIG. 1 is a plan view of the bath car, and FIG. 2 is a side view of the bath car. As shown in FIG.1 and FIG.2, the bathing vehicle 1 of this invention is equipped with the bathtub 2 which can be taken out outside a vehicle. Moreover, the bath 1 of the present invention includes a water storage tank 3 for storing bath water, a hot water boiler 4 for heating the bath water stored in the water storage tank 3, and a hot water boiler 4 as bath water supply devices. A kerosene tank 5 for storing kerosene serving as the fuel, and a water feed pump 6 for sending out bath water in the water storage tank 3. A smoke exhaust cylinder 11 is attached to the hot water supply boiler 4, and smoke generated from the hot water supply boiler 4 is guided to the outside of the vehicle by the smoke exhaust cylinder 11 and exhausted.

車内の床面には載置台7が配設されており、その載置台7の前部に貯水タンク3が載置され、後部にホースを巻き付けた2つのホースリール8,9が載置されている。また、貯水タンク3の上面には、ガイドレール18が設けられ、そのガイドレール18上に浴槽2が載置されている。   A mounting table 7 is disposed on the floor of the vehicle. The water storage tank 3 is mounted on the front portion of the mounting table 7 and two hose reels 8 and 9 each having a hose wound are mounted on the rear portion. Yes. A guide rail 18 is provided on the upper surface of the water storage tank 3, and the bathtub 2 is placed on the guide rail 18.

ホースリール8,9の右側には、浴槽2から浴用水を排出するための排水ポンプ13が載置されている。一方、ホースリール8,9の左側には、上記送水ポンプ6や給湯ボイラー4等を操作するための操作盤12が配設されている。また、車内の天井には、入浴の際に入浴対象者を浴槽2に運ぶための入浴担架10が着脱可能に吊り下げられている。   A drainage pump 13 for discharging bath water from the bathtub 2 is placed on the right side of the hose reels 8 and 9. On the other hand, on the left side of the hose reels 8 and 9, there is disposed an operation panel 12 for operating the water supply pump 6, the hot water boiler 4 and the like. Also, a bathing stretcher 10 for detaching a bathing person to the bathtub 2 during bathing is detachably suspended from the ceiling of the vehicle.

また、入浴車1の車内後部に、上記貯水タンク3に外部から浴用水を供給するための給水口15と、貯水タンク3内の浴用水を加熱しない水のままで外部に送り出す送水口16と、貯水タンク3内の浴用水を加熱した湯水を外部に送り出す送湯口17が配設されている。上記2つのホースリール8,9に巻き付けられたホースのうち、一方は送水口16に接続され、他方は送湯口17に接続されている。   Further, a water supply port 15 for supplying bath water to the water storage tank 3 from the outside, and a water supply port 16 for sending the bath water in the water storage tank 3 to the outside as unheated water are provided at the rear of the bath car 1. A hot water supply port 17 for sending hot water heated from the bath water in the water storage tank 3 to the outside is disposed. Of the hoses wound around the two hose reels 8 and 9, one is connected to the water supply port 16 and the other is connected to the hot water supply port 17.

図3及び図4に基づいて、本発明の第1実施形態である車両用扉のロック機構の構成について説明する。図3及び図4は、前記入浴車1の後部の側面図であり、図3は後部の扉19を閉じた状態を示し、図4は前記扉19を開けた状態を示している。   Based on FIG.3 and FIG.4, the structure of the locking mechanism of the vehicle door which is 1st Embodiment of this invention is demonstrated. 3 and 4 are side views of the rear portion of the bath car 1, FIG. 3 shows a state in which the rear door 19 is closed, and FIG. 4 shows a state in which the door 19 is opened.

図3に示すように、車体20の後部に開閉可能に取り付けられた扉19を閉じた状態でロックするためのロック機構として、予め車体20と扉19にそれぞれロック部21,22が設けてある。この場合、扉19に設けてある扉側ロック部21は、揺動する爪状のラッチであり、車体20に設けてある車体側ロック部22は、前記ラッチ等が係合可能なコ字形のストライカである。ただし、扉側ロック部21及び車体側ロック部22は、上記ラッチとストライカに限らず、公知のロック機構を適用可能である。   As shown in FIG. 3, lock portions 21 and 22 are provided in advance in the vehicle body 20 and the door 19, respectively, as a lock mechanism for locking the door 19 attached to the rear portion of the vehicle body 20 so that it can be opened and closed. . In this case, the door-side lock portion 21 provided on the door 19 is a swinging claw-shaped latch, and the vehicle-body-side lock portion 22 provided on the vehicle body 20 is a U-shape that can be engaged with the latch and the like. It is a striker. However, the door side lock part 21 and the vehicle body side lock part 22 are not limited to the latch and the striker, and a known lock mechanism can be applied.

また、入浴車1は、上記車体側ロック部22とは別に、扉側ロック部21に係合可能なロック部材23を備えている。このロック部材23は、揺動可能な揺動部材24を介して車体20の後部に取り付けられている。揺動部材24は、その一端部24aが蝶番等を介して車体20に枢着され、それと反対側の揺動する他端部24bにロック部材23が付設されている。   Further, the bath car 1 includes a lock member 23 that can be engaged with the door-side lock portion 21, in addition to the vehicle body-side lock portion 22. The lock member 23 is attached to the rear portion of the vehicle body 20 via a swingable swinging member 24. One end portion 24a of the swing member 24 is pivotally attached to the vehicle body 20 via a hinge or the like, and a lock member 23 is attached to the other end portion 24b swinging on the opposite side.

図4に示すように、扉19を開けた状態では、揺動部材24を後方(車外側)へ完全に揺動させることができ、この状態でロック部材23は車体側ロック部22よりも車体20の外側に配置されるようになっている。また、ロック部材23が車体側ロック部22よりも外側に配置された状態で、扉19を開閉するときの扉側ロック部21の移動経路Bにロック部材23が重なるように、揺動部材24の長さやロック部材23の取付位置が設定されている。一方、揺動部材24を前方(車内側)へ完全に揺動させた場合は、ロック部材23は車体側ロック部22よりも車体20の内側に配置されるようになっている(図3参照)。このように、揺動部材24を揺動させることによって、ロック部材23は車体側ロック部22に対して車体20の内外に出没可能となっている。   As shown in FIG. 4, when the door 19 is opened, the swing member 24 can be completely swung back (outside of the vehicle). 20 is arranged outside. Further, in a state where the lock member 23 is disposed outside the vehicle body side lock portion 22, the swing member 24 is arranged so that the lock member 23 overlaps the movement path B of the door side lock portion 21 when the door 19 is opened and closed. And the mounting position of the lock member 23 are set. On the other hand, when the swing member 24 is completely swung forward (inside the vehicle), the lock member 23 is arranged inside the vehicle body 20 relative to the vehicle body side lock portion 22 (see FIG. 3). ). In this way, by swinging the swing member 24, the lock member 23 can be moved in and out of the vehicle body 20 with respect to the vehicle body side lock portion 22.

図5に本発明の車両用扉のロック機構の第2実施形態を示す。この実施形態は、長さの異なる揺動部材24を複数種類備えている。さらに、各揺動部材24は車体に対して着脱可能に構成されている。   FIG. 5 shows a second embodiment of the vehicle door locking mechanism of the present invention. This embodiment includes a plurality of types of swing members 24 having different lengths. Furthermore, each swing member 24 is configured to be detachable from the vehicle body.

また、図6に本発明の第3実施形態を示す。図6(a)は揺動部材24の側面断面図であり、図6(b)は図6(a)のA−A断面図である。この実施形態は、揺動部材24を長手方向(車体の内外方向)に伸縮可能に構成している。詳しくは、図6(a)(b)に示すように、揺動部材24は、車体に枢着された支持部材240と、先端にロック部材23を付設した取付部材241を有する。支持部材240は幅方向の両端縁に一対のガイド部240aを有し、一対のガイド部240aの間に取付部材241が配設されている。また、支持部材240はその長手方向に延在した長孔240bを有し、一方、取付部材241のロック部材23を付設した端部と反対側の端部にネジ孔241aが形成されている。ボルト等の固定具242を長孔240bに挿通すると共に、ネジ孔241aに螺合させて取付部材241を締め付けることによって、取付部材241は支持部材240に固定される。また、固定具242による締結を緩めることによって、取付部材241は支持部材240の長手方向にスライド可能となる。そして、スライドさせた取付部材241を任意の位置において固定具242で固定することにより、揺動部材24の全長を伸縮させることができるようになっている。   FIG. 6 shows a third embodiment of the present invention. 6A is a side cross-sectional view of the swing member 24, and FIG. 6B is a cross-sectional view taken along line AA of FIG. 6A. In this embodiment, the swing member 24 is configured to be extendable and contractible in the longitudinal direction (inside and outside of the vehicle body). Specifically, as shown in FIGS. 6A and 6B, the swing member 24 includes a support member 240 pivotally attached to the vehicle body and an attachment member 241 provided with a lock member 23 at the tip. The support member 240 has a pair of guide portions 240a at both end edges in the width direction, and an attachment member 241 is disposed between the pair of guide portions 240a. Further, the support member 240 has a long hole 240b extending in the longitudinal direction thereof, and a screw hole 241a is formed at an end of the mounting member 241 opposite to the end provided with the lock member 23. The fixing member 242 such as a bolt is inserted into the long hole 240b, and the mounting member 241 is fastened by being screwed into the screw hole 241a, thereby fixing the mounting member 241 to the support member 240. Further, by loosening the fastening by the fixing tool 242, the attachment member 241 can slide in the longitudinal direction of the support member 240. Then, by fixing the slidable mounting member 241 with a fixture 242 at an arbitrary position, the entire length of the swinging member 24 can be expanded and contracted.

また、上記本発明の各実施形態において、揺動部材24を所定の角度又は任意の角度で固定するための角度固定手段を設けてもよい(図示省略)。角度固定手段は、例えば揺動部材24と車体の床面との間に介在させるストッパーや、揺動部材24の枢着部に摩擦力を発生させるもの等、公知の技術を任意に選択して適用することが可能である。   In each embodiment of the present invention, angle fixing means for fixing the swing member 24 at a predetermined angle or an arbitrary angle may be provided (not shown). For the angle fixing means, for example, a known technique such as a stopper interposed between the swinging member 24 and the floor of the vehicle body, or a means for generating a frictional force on the pivoting portion of the swinging member 24 is arbitrarily selected. It is possible to apply.

以下、上記入浴車の使用方法について説明する。
まず、入浴車1の車内に設けた給水口15(図1参照)と水道の蛇口等を、給水ホースを介して接続して、水道水を貯水タンク3貯留する。なお、貯水タンク3への貯水作業は、水道設備が備えてある場所であれば、出発地又は訪問先のどちらで行ってもよい。
Hereinafter, the method of using the bath car will be described.
First, a water supply port 15 (see FIG. 1) provided in the bathing car 1 is connected to a water tap through a water supply hose to store tap water in the water storage tank 3. Note that the water storage work to the water storage tank 3 may be performed at either the departure place or the visited place as long as the water supply facilities are provided.

入浴車1を走らせ、訪問先に到着後、図7に示すように、後部の扉19を開放し、浴槽2を車内から運び出して、それを訪問先へ運び込んで適切な位置に設置する。また、ホースリール8,9からそれぞれホースを引き出し、送水口16に接続された一方のホースHを、浴槽2に設けた給水口(図示省略)に接続し、送湯口17に接続された他方のホースHを浴槽2に設けた給湯口(図示省略)を接続する。これにより、貯水タンク3内の浴用水を、加熱しない水のまま、あるいは湯水にして浴槽2へ送れるようになる。   After the bath car 1 is run and arrives at the visited place, as shown in FIG. 7, the rear door 19 is opened, the bathtub 2 is taken out of the car, and it is carried to the visited place and installed at an appropriate position. Further, the hoses are pulled out from the hose reels 8 and 9 respectively, and one hose H connected to the water supply port 16 is connected to a water supply port (not shown) provided in the bathtub 2 and the other hose connected to the hot water supply port 17 is connected. A hot water supply port (not shown) provided with the hose H in the bathtub 2 is connected. Thereby, the bath water in the water storage tank 3 can be sent to the bathtub 2 as unheated water or hot water.

また、扉19を開放した後、図4に示すように、揺動部材24を後方(車外側)へ揺動させてロック部材23を車体側ロック部22よりも後方(車外側)へ突出した突出状態にする。   After the door 19 is opened, as shown in FIG. 4, the rocking member 24 is swung rearward (vehicle outer side), and the lock member 23 protrudes rearward (vehicle outer side) from the vehicle body side lock portion 22. Make it protruding.

そして、図8に示すように、扉19を閉める方向に移動させ、扉側ロック部21をロック部材23に係合させることにより、扉19と車体20との隙間Sを形成した状態でロックすることができる。これにより、図9に示すように、車体の内外に渡って延びるホースHを前記隙間Sに挿通させて配設することができ、扉19と車体20との間にホースHを挟まずに扉19をロックすることができる。   Then, as shown in FIG. 8, the door 19 is moved in the closing direction, and the door-side lock portion 21 is engaged with the lock member 23 to lock the door 19 and the vehicle body 20 with a gap S formed therebetween. be able to. As a result, as shown in FIG. 9, the hose H extending in and out of the vehicle body can be inserted through the gap S, and the door without the hose H being sandwiched between the door 19 and the vehicle body 20. 19 can be locked.

また、図1に示す操作盤12を操作して、送水ポンプ6を作動させれば、貯水タンク3内の浴用水を加熱されない水のままで浴槽2へ供給することができる。また、操作盤12を操作して、給湯ボイラー4と送水ポンプ6を作動させることにより、貯水タンク3内の浴用水を給湯ボイラー4で加熱して湯水にしてから浴槽2へ供給することができる。このように水の供給量と湯水の供給量を調整して、浴槽2を適温の浴用水で満たし、入浴対象者を入浴させる。   Moreover, if the operation panel 12 shown in FIG. 1 is operated and the water pump 6 is operated, the bath water in the water storage tank 3 can be supplied to the bathtub 2 with the water not heated. Further, by operating the hot water supply boiler 4 and the water supply pump 6 by operating the operation panel 12, the bath water in the water storage tank 3 can be heated by the hot water supply boiler 4 to be hot water and then supplied to the bathtub 2. . Thus, the supply amount of water and the supply amount of hot water are adjusted, the bathtub 2 is filled with the bath water of appropriate temperature, and a bath subject is bathed.

入浴を終えた後は、図1に示す排水ポンプ13を浴槽2内に入れ、排水を行う。排水後、入浴設備の撤去作業を行う場合は、図8に示すロック部材23と扉側ロック部21との係合を解除し、再度扉19を開放する。そして、浴槽2を訪問先から搬出して車内へ搬入し、各ホースを各ホースリール8,9に巻き取る。   After bathing, the drain pump 13 shown in FIG. When the bathing facility is removed after draining, the engagement between the lock member 23 and the door-side lock portion 21 shown in FIG. 8 is released, and the door 19 is opened again. And the bathtub 2 is taken out from a visited place and carried into the vehicle, and each hose is wound around each hose reel 8, 9.

次いで、揺動部材24を前方(車内側)へ揺動させることにより、ロック部材23を車体側ロック部22の後方から退避させて車内側へ収納する(図3参照)。この状態で、扉側ロック部21と車体側ロック部22とを係合することができ、扉19を閉じてロックして、撤去作業が完了する。   Next, the rocking member 24 is swung forward (inside the vehicle), whereby the lock member 23 is retracted from the rear of the vehicle body side lock portion 22 and stored inside the vehicle (see FIG. 3). In this state, the door side lock part 21 and the vehicle body side lock part 22 can be engaged, the door 19 is closed and locked, and the removal work is completed.

また、図5に示す本発明の第2実施形態の場合は、長さの異なる揺動部材24を複数種類備えているので、これら揺動部材24を車体に付け替えることによって、ロック部材23の車体側ロック部22に対する後方(車外側)への突出量を変えることが可能である。これにより、隙間Sに挿通させるホース等の大きさに応じて、隙間Sの大きさを変えることができる。   Further, in the case of the second embodiment of the present invention shown in FIG. 5, since a plurality of types of swing members 24 having different lengths are provided, by replacing these swing members 24 with the vehicle body, the vehicle body of the lock member 23 is provided. It is possible to change the amount of protrusion of the side lock portion 22 toward the rear (vehicle outer side). Thereby, according to the magnitude | size of the hose etc. which are penetrated in the clearance gap S, the magnitude | size of the clearance gap S can be changed.

また、図6に示す本発明の第3実施形態の場合は、揺動部材24を長手方向に伸縮させることによって、隙間Sの大きさを変えることが可能である。さらに、図示しない角度固定手段によって、揺動部材24の角度を所定の角度に固定すれば、扉側ロック部21とロック部材23との係合をより行いやすくすることができる。   In the case of the third embodiment of the present invention shown in FIG. 6, the size of the gap S can be changed by expanding and contracting the swing member 24 in the longitudinal direction. Furthermore, if the angle of the swing member 24 is fixed to a predetermined angle by an angle fixing means (not shown), the door side lock portion 21 and the lock member 23 can be more easily engaged.

上記のように、本発明は、扉側ロック部21を、車体側ロック部22よりも車外に突出したロック部材23に係合させることによって、扉19と車体20との間に隙間Sを形成した状態で扉19をロックすることができる。これにより、車内と車外との間で延びるホースが扉19で挟まれるのを防止することができると共に、車内に設けた機材や貴重品等の盗難や車内への雨水の浸入等を防止することができる。   As described above, the present invention forms the clearance S between the door 19 and the vehicle body 20 by engaging the door-side lock portion 21 with the lock member 23 that protrudes outside the vehicle than the vehicle-body side lock portion 22. In this state, the door 19 can be locked. As a result, it is possible to prevent the hose extending between the inside of the vehicle and the outside of the vehicle from being pinched by the door 19, and to prevent theft of equipment and valuables provided in the vehicle and the intrusion of rainwater into the vehicle. Can do.

また、本発明の車両用扉のロック機構によれば、従来のように給湯装置の送湯口等を車外に露出させて配設しなくてもよくなる。従って、本発明は、図1に示すように、送水口16及び送湯口17を車内に配設することによって、配管構造などを簡単にすることができるので、製造コストの低減が図れる。さらに、送水口16及び送湯口17を車内に配設することによって、ホースを送水口16及び送湯口17に連結したままにしておくことができ、入浴設備の設置作業や撤去作業の作業性を向上させることができる。   In addition, according to the vehicle door locking mechanism of the present invention, it is not necessary to place the hot water supply port of the hot water supply device exposed outside the vehicle as in the prior art. Therefore, as shown in FIG. 1, the present invention can simplify the piping structure and the like by disposing the water supply port 16 and the hot water supply port 17 in the vehicle, so that the manufacturing cost can be reduced. Furthermore, by arranging the water supply port 16 and the hot water supply port 17 in the vehicle, the hose can be kept connected to the water supply port 16 and the hot water supply port 17, and the workability of the installation and removal work of the bathing facility can be improved. Can be improved.

なお、本発明の構成を、上記送水口16や送湯口17を車外に露出させた入浴車に適用してもよい。この場合も、図10に示すように、車外に露出した送水口16や送湯口17から車内のホースリール8(9)へ延びたホースHや、ホースリール8(9)から訪問作に配設した浴槽へ延びたホースHを、隙間Sを挿通させることによって扉19で挟まずに使用することが可能である。これにより、従来のようにホースリール8(9)を車外に運び出さなくてもよくなり、作業性を向上させることができる。   In addition, you may apply the structure of this invention to the bathing vehicle which exposed the said water supply port 16 and the hot water supply port 17 outside the vehicle. Also in this case, as shown in FIG. 10, the hose H extending from the water supply port 16 and the hot water supply port 17 exposed to the outside of the vehicle to the hose reel 8 (9) in the vehicle and the hose reel 8 (9) are arranged in the visiting work. The hose H extended to the bathtub can be used without being pinched by the door 19 by inserting the gap S. As a result, the hose reel 8 (9) need not be carried out of the vehicle as in the conventional case, and workability can be improved.

また、扉19と車体20との間に隙間Sを形成した状態で扉19をロックすることができるため、車外に多少はみ出すような機材や荷物等であっても収容することが可能である。   Further, since the door 19 can be locked in a state in which the gap S is formed between the door 19 and the vehicle body 20, even equipment or luggage that protrudes slightly outside the vehicle can be accommodated.

以上、本発明の車両用扉のロック機構を入浴車に適用した実施形態について説明したが、本発明の車両用扉のロック機構は、入浴車以外の車両にも適用可能である。   As mentioned above, although embodiment which applied the locking mechanism of the vehicle door of this invention to the bathing vehicle was described, the locking mechanism of the vehicle door of this invention is applicable also to vehicles other than a bathing vehicle.
